If you are meaning a "facing" I use a facing when I do art quilts, where I want a nice, sharp edge without the intrusion of another fabric around the edge, which a binding would make.

It's just another technique that can add to your quilt, depending on the look you are going for.

Otherwise, the only time I use interfacing is when I am using specialty stitches on my tops, so that the stitches lie flat.
